What You Should Know About Casinos

A casino is a place where people can gamble on games of chance. These establishments have gaming facilities such as blackjack, baccarat and video poker. They also offer other amenities such as restaurants and stage shows. They can be found in many cities around the world, including Las Vegas. They can be large and impressive, with dazzling lights and mindblowing numbers of games.

Most casino games have odds that give the house an edge over the players. The odds of a particular game are mathematically determined and are uniformly negative from the player’s perspective. This advantage is known as the house edge or expected value. Casinos make money by charging a commission on the games or by taking a percentage of the bets. They can also give away complimentary items or comps to their players.

In addition to gaming facilities, many casinos have other attractions that attract customers. These may include restaurants, shops, stage shows and dramatic scenery. While these extras don’t necessarily increase the casino’s profitability, they can create a positive image for the company and draw in potential customers who might not otherwise visit the facility. For example, the elegant spa town of Baden-Baden attracted royalty and aristocracy 150 years ago and is considered one of the most beautiful casinos in the world. Its baroque flourishes and red-and-gold décor were inspired by the Palace of Versailles. It is now home to a casino that attracts visitors from across Europe.
